The choice about where to position a ceiling fan matters just as much as the fan itself, and this is where numerous Sydney property owners undervalue the planning needed before ceiling fan installation begins. Centring the fan within the space is the standard technique, but it is not constantly the most effective one. In open-plan spaces where the cooking area, dining, and living areas combine into one large footprint, a single centrally placed fan seldom delivers appropriate airflow to every corner. Multiple smaller fans positioned attentively across the get more info area will outshine one large fan each time. Rooms with raked or risen ceilings provide their own obstacle, requiring angled canopy adaptors throughout ceiling fan installation to ensure the motor real estate sits level and the blades move air straight down rather than at an ineffective diagonal.
Colour, surface, and blade product are options that property owners often deal with as purely aesthetic during the ceiling fan installation process, but they bring useful effects as well. Wood blades add heat and character to a room however can warp in environments with high humidity or considerable temperature swings, which is a real consideration for Sydney residential or commercial properties near to the water or with bad roof insulation. Moulded composite blades resist warping and are much easier to wipe down, making them a more resilient long-term choice for many homes. The fan's motor real estate finish need to likewise be thought about in relation to the environment-- brushed nickel and matte black are both popular in modern Sydney interiors, however particular coatings hold up much better than others in homes exposed to coastal conditions. These details are worth raising with the provider before committing to a ceiling fan installation instead of discovering them as issues afterwards.
Arranging a ceiling‑fan installation at the correct time can considerably smooth the procedure. Scheduling a certified electrician throughout the slower autumn and winter season durations generally results in quicker appointments, lower rates, and a tradesperson who isn't rushed in between jobs. It likewise makes sure the fan is set up and tested well before summer season, getting rid of the pressure of last‑minute work throughout peak demand. When a property is being redesigned, integrating the fan installation with other electrical tasks is much more cost-effective than revisiting later on, as the electrician can lay new circuits, evaluate the switchboard's capacity, and location conduit before the ceilings are finished and painted.
